>>You are probably doing sessionHome.create() on every request?
>>
>>This creates a new remote interface proxy, which will
>>round-robin all servers. However if you only do one
>>invocation it will always use the first server and never get
>>to the others.
>>
>>You can get similar problems with other patterns in your
>>RemoteInterface usage depending upon how many servers you have.
>>
>>One simple solution is to use RandomRobin rather than
>>RoundRobin as the load balancing policy.
